Secondary Mathematics Teacher
Position: Mathematics Teacher (Key Stages 3–4/5)
Start Date: Immediate
Location: Wickford
About the Role
We are seeking an enthusiastic, knowledgeable, and committed Mathematics Teacher to join our dedicated secondary teaching team. The successful candidate will inspire students, foster a deep understanding of mathematics, and help learners build confidence in their problem-solving abilities.
Key Responsibilities
Teach Mathematics across Key Stages 3 and 4 (and 5 if applicable)
Plan and deliver engaging, differentiated lessons aligned with the curriculum
Assess student progress through a variety of formative and summative methods
Provide clear, constructive feedback to support academic development
Contribute to departmental planning, curriculum development, and enrichment activities
Maintain high expectations for student behaviour and achievement
Work collaboratively with colleagues, parents, and support staff
Participate in school events, staff meetings, and professional development sessions
Essential Qualifications & Skills
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ent
A degree in Mathematics or a closely related field
Strong subject knowledge and understanding of pedagogical best practice
Ability to motivate and inspire learners of varying abilities
Excellent communication, organisational, and classroom-management skills
Comm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of young people
Desirable Attributes
Experience teaching Mathematics at GCSE and/or A-Level
Willingness to contribute to extracurricular activities
A reflective practitioner with a passion for continuous improvement
